Spanish

Dictionaries

A good place to browse for Spanish dictionaries (in Spanish only) is call number PC 4625, both in the reference area on 1st floor and the regular shelves on 3rd floor.

A good place to browse for Spanish-English dictionaries is call number PC 4640, both in reference and on 3rd floor. 

Please note that all of the dictionaries in reference are non-circulating.  Some of the ones on the regular shelves are also non-circulating, but there are some that can be checked out.
